

American Dad! (2005)
S17E9 Exquisite Corpses
Jeff, Francine, and Roger join forces to launch their own bus tour company, but things take a deadly turn.
Jeff, Francine, and Roger join forces to launch their own bus tour company, but things take a deadly turn.